ML4EP - TMVA SOFIE

Enhancing Keras Parser and JAX/FLAX Integration

Prasanna Kasar

Prasanna Kasar

Developed a parser within SOFIE to parse Machine Learning models trained with Keras. Rewrote the existing parser in Python, which was previously written in C++. Added support for parsing missing layers, such as Pooling and LayerNormalization, and wrote unit tests for the parser.

Intelligent Log Analysis for the HSF Conditions Database

Intelligent Logging Pipeline

Osama Ahmed Tahir

Osama Ahmed Tahir

An intelligent logging pipeline for NopayloadDB that integrates log aggregation, anomaly detection, and monitoring. It improves reliability and maintainability in large-scale HEP experiments It is deployed on Minikube cluster while using a deep learning model for real-time anomaly detection.

ATLAS

Neural (De)compression for High Energy Physics

Yolanne Lee

Yolanne Lee

In high-energy physics experiments such as those at CERN’s ATLAS project, immense volumes of data are generated. This project explores the feasibility for “precision upsampling” using deep generative models to be used to reconstruct high-precision floating-point data from aggressively compressed representations.
